== Manx ==
=== Alternative forms ===
oard
=== Etymology ===
From Old Irish ordaigid (“to order, to command”), from ord (“order, sequence, arrangement”), a learned borrowing from Latin ōrdō (“order, rank”). Cognate with Irish ordaigh and Scottish Gaelic òrdaich.
=== Verb ===
oardee (verbal noun oardaghey)
to order
to dispense
to ordain
to command
to commission
to rank
to authorize
to decree
